In the evolving world of fashion, choosing between lined and unlined jackets hinges on a practical assessment of climate, layering habits, and personal comfort. A lined jacket offers dependable warmth, structure, and a polished silhouette, especially when over lightweight sweaters or shirts. It tends to hold its shape longer through daily wear and adds a subtle formality suitable for professional settings or evening events. For those who experience dramatic temperature swings, a lightweight lined piece can bridge seasons without feeling bulky. Consider the weight and fabric of the lining, as a smooth satin or knit blend can minimize bulk while maximizing warmth. The balance of texture, color, and weight matters as much as the cut itself.
For climates with milder winters or damp springs, an unlined jacket can be a versatile staple. It provides breathability, ease of movement, and a casual air that pairs well with jeans, chinos, or skirts. An unlined option shines when frequent layering is expected, since you can add sweaters or thermal tops without feeling restricted. The absence of a heavy lining often reduces bulk, making it ideal for travel and business trips where long days in variable weather demand quick adjustments. When selecting unlined designs, focus on the outer fabric’s resilience, the quality of shoulder construction, and pocket placement, all of which influence both comfort and practicality over time.

The first step in strategy is to map your local seasons with honesty, listing typical high and low temperatures, humidity, and wind exposure. If you live where mornings are crisp but afternoons warm, a mid-weight lined jacket or a structured unlined shell can cover the transition. Fabrics such as wool blends, cotton twill, or gabardine offer durable warmth without excessive bulk, while water-resistant finishes add practical value. Consider how the garment layers with existing wardrobes: a tailored lined piece over a thin turtleneck or a casual unlined jacket over a lightweight knit can yield multiple looks from a single purchase. Visualize week-to-week outfit combinations to avoid layering-induced discomfort.

Another critical factor is mobility and comfort. A jacket that restricts arm movement or creates stiff corners around the shoulders will quickly become a fashion liability, even if it looks sharp on a hanger. For lined jackets, check the interior seam finishes and the distribution of the lining against the outer shell; poorly aligned linings can bunch and distort the silhouette. For unlined jackets, inspect the shoulder, back, and sleeve construction to ensure a smooth drape without pulling at the chest. The color story should support easy mixing with existing pieces, lowering decision fatigue during busy mornings. Invest in a few timeless colors—navy, charcoal, camel—so versatility remains high across seasons.

A practical rule of thumb is to reserve lined jackets for days when you anticipate the need for reliable warmth without compromising a crisp profile. In cooler environments, a lined piece signposts structure and polish, making it a go-to for professional settings or formal gatherings. When your routine demands flexibility, an unlined option can evolve with you, supporting spontaneous layers and dynamic silhouettes. The decision should hinge on your typical daily activities, as well as how often you rotate outerwear during travel. If you frequently move between indoor and outdoor spaces, the versatility of a lighter unlined jacket becomes a strategic benefit, reducing packing stress and wardrobe constraints.

Fabric choice influences both performance and longevity. Wool, tweed, or boiled wool offer enduring warmth and a tactile richness that enhances a dressed-up aesthetic, while cotton blends and lightweight polyesters provide easy-care convenience and everyday practicality. Pay attention to the garment’s weight per square meter and its breathability, which determine comfort in transitional weather. A lined jacket with a breathable lining can manage moisture better, preventing overheating in humid climates. Conversely, an unlined garment that relies on high-quality outer fabric can endure daily wear with fewer maintenance requirements. Consider care labels and the ability to refresh textures with gentle brushing or steaming, preserving shape and color.

Beyond warmth, jackets function as key style anchors that influence the entire ensemble. A lined jacket often lends structure to a sleek ensemble, enabling a neat, put-together look for business meetings or formal events. It can be paired with dress pants, midi skirts, or tailored dresses to create coherent lines. An unlined option invites relaxed confidence, working well with casual dresses, denim, or cords for weekend activities. For a capsule wardrobe, choose one lined piece for refinement and one unlined piece for ease. Ensure both have clean lines, minimal hardware, and timeless silhouettes to maximize lifespan across trends and age groups.
Footfall and accessory choices also shape the overall impression. When wearing a lined jacket, select complementary footwear—polished loafers, sleek boots, or elegant flats—that echo the garment’s tailored intent. A lighter unlined jacket pairs naturally with sneakers, ankle boots, or combat styles for a modern, street-smart vibe. Accessories such as scarves, belts, and minimalist jewelry can harmonize with either option, acting as connective tissue between layers. The goal is to maintain balance: avoid overpowering the jacket’s silhouette with loud prints or excessive volume. A consistent color story across the outfit supports effortless transitions from day to night.

Before committing to a purchase, test the garment’s behavior in real-life situations. Try sitting for extended periods, bending, reaching, and lifting a bag to observe how the fabric responds. A lined jacket should maintain a smooth line at the waist and chest, with the lining unobtrusively following the outer shell. An unlined jacket should feel flexible and lightly draped, with seams that stay flat under pressure. If possible, wear the piece with your typical layers to gauge warmth and comfort across the day. Pay attention to ventilation during warmer moments to avoid overheating, which undermines both function and enjoyment of the piece.
Seasonal versatility emerges when you integrate outerwear with your calendar. A foundation wardrobe thrives on transitional choices that bridge winter and spring or autumn and early winter. For instance, a medium-weight lined jacket works well under a heavier coat on very cold days while still teaming gracefully with lighter layers on brisk mornings. An unlined version functions as a transitional layer that can be added or removed with ease, reducing the feel of bulk while preserving style. The trick is to maintain consistent garment maintenance—regular cleaning, proper storage, and timely repairs—to extend the life of each piece and maximize return on investment.
The best jackets honor diverse body shapes by offering thoughtful fits and adjustable features. Look for designs with contoured sides, darts, or princess seams that enhance shape without pressuring sensitive areas. A lined jacket may benefit from removable linings or light feathering at the hem to accommodate different torso lengths and postural differences. An unlined jacket should also consider fit via shoulder shaping and sleeve length because those details strongly influence perceived balance. Try on multiple sizes and consider tailoring as a final step; a small alteration can transform a solid piece into a perfect fit that feels both comfortable and flattering across ages.
